Abstract

A power compensation differential scanning calorimeter that uses one absolute temperature measurement, two differential temperature measurements, a differential power measurement, and a five-term heat flow equation to measure the sample heat flow. The calorimeter is calibrated by running two sequential calibration experiments. In a preferred embodiment, the first calibration experiment uses empty sample and reference pans, and the second calibration experiment uses sapphire specimens in the sample and reference holders. In an alternate embodiment, sapphire calibration specimens are used in both the first and second calibration experiments.
